SHREVEPORT, La. — Students from across the country have concluded a summer of intensive scientific research at LSU Health Shreveport.

Medical and undergraduate participants spent the season working alongside faculty researchers in campus laboratories, gaining hands-on experience in healthcare and science. The program helps students develop professional skills, build networks, and contribute to ongoing studies.
